generatorConfig.xml 2.3 KB

1234567891011121314151617181920212223242526272829303132333435363738394041424344
  1. <?xml version="1.0" encoding="UTF-8"?>
  2. <!DOCTYPE generatorConfiguration
  3. PUBLIC "-//mybatis.org//DTD MyBatis Generator Configuration 1.0//EN"
  4. "http://mybatis.org/dtd/mybatis-generator-config_1_0.dtd">
  5. <generatorConfiguration>
  6. <properties resource="generator.properties"/>
  7. <context id="MySqlContext" targetRuntime="MyBatis3" defaultModelType="flat">
  8. <property name="beginningDelimiter" value="`"/>
  9. <property name="endingDelimiter" value="`"/>
  10. <property name="javaFileEncoding" value="UTF-8"/>
  11. <!-- 为模型生成序列化方法-->
  12. <plugin type="org.mybatis.generator.plugins.SerializablePlugin"/>
  13. <!-- 为生成的Java模型创建一个toString方法 -->
  14. <plugin type="org.mybatis.generator.plugins.ToStringPlugin"/>
  15. <!--生成mapper.xml时覆盖原文件-->
  16. <plugin type="org.mybatis.generator.plugins.UnmergeableXmlMappersPlugin" />
  17. <commentGenerator type="com.hwrj.cloud.admin.CommentGenerator">
  18. <!-- 是否去除自动生成的注释 true:是 : false:否 -->
  19. <property name="suppressAllComments" value="true"/>
  20. <property name="suppressDate" value="true"/>
  21. <property name="addRemarkComments" value="true"/>
  22. </commentGenerator>
  23. <jdbcConnection driverClass="${jdbc.driverClass}"
  24. connectionURL="${jdbc.connectionURL}"
  25. userId="${jdbc.userId}"
  26. password="${jdbc.password}">
  27. <!--解决mysql驱动升级到8.0后不生成指定数据库代码的问题-->
  28. <property name="nullCatalogMeansCurrent" value="true" />
  29. </jdbcConnection>
  30. <javaModelGenerator targetPackage="com.hwrj.cloud.admin.model" targetProject="forest-admin\admin-mbg\src\main\java"/>
  31. <sqlMapGenerator targetPackage="com.hwrj.cloud.admin.mapper" targetProject="forest-admin\admin-mbg\src\main\resources"/>
  32. <javaClientGenerator type="XMLMAPPER" targetPackage="com.hwrj.cloud.admin.mapper"
  33. targetProject="forest-admin\admin-mbg\src\main\java"/>
  34. <!--生成全部表tableName设为%-->
  35. <table tableName="pms_product">
  36. <generatedKey column="id" sqlStatement="MySql" identity="true"/>
  37. </table>
  38. </context>
  39. </generatorConfiguration>